[Code of Federal Regulations] [Title 46, Volume 2] [Revised as of October 1, 2004] From the U.S. Government Printing Office via GPO Access [CITE: 46CFR69.17] [Page 389] TITLE 46--SHIPPING CHAPTER I--COAST GUARD, DEPARTMENT OF HOMELAND SECURITY (CONTINUED) PART 69_MEASUREMENT OF VESSELS--Table of Contents Subpart A_General Sec. 69.17 Application for measurement services. (a) Applications for measurement are available from and, once completed, are submitted to the authorized measurement organization that will perform the services. The contents of the application are described in this part under the requirement for each system. (b) Applications for measurement under more than one system may be combined. (c) For vessels under construction, the application must be submitted before the vessel is advanced in construction. Usually, this means as soon as the decks are laid, holds cleared of encumbrances, engine and boilers installed, and accommodations partitioned.
